We live in Benijofar and my daughter is coming to stay with us for 6 months, she has a job in the UK and will continue to work from here, does she have to do anything regarding legal obligations?

Any advice would be gratefully accepted 

Thank you

Hi Shelagh,

Anyone intending to exceed 90 days in Spain should register as an Extranjero (foreigner) here, which is the same process as residency.  However, so long as your daughter doesn't exceed 182 days here this year (otherwise she would become tax resident in Spain by default) and she leaves before the end of the Brexit transition period on 31 December 2020(to ensure she doesn't get caught by post-Brexit Schengen travel rules), I can't think of anything else that would be a problem.  She will need to bring her EHIC, in case she has a medical emergency whilst she's here.
